Ive been noticing in my hunt for a big block vette that there are what appears to be 2 types of hoods for the big blocks (1968-1972). I still consider myself a newbie in this regard so I finally dug up 2 pictures of what Im confused on. I added the year just for reference, it does seem that most of my searches come up with the hood type shown on this 1968 vette.

Are these both factory hoods?
Does one type denote a tri-power engine?

The hood in the second picture is a cowl induction hood used on L88 and ZL1 engines.
 
First pic is the BB/LT1 type hood used on the 68-72 models. 68 and 69 tri-power engines used this hood. Second pic is the L-88 style hood.
